WebThe enormous Roman mosaic of Noheda. More than 230 square meters is the space occupied by the mosaic of the Roman villa of Noheda. That is a good part of the room of about 14 by 18 meters that contains it, which has about 300 square meters of surface. A major work developed with a careful technique.
